Scribd actively updates its security protocols and digital rights management (DRM) systems to block these scrapers. Consequently, most free downloaders do not work. They often generate corrupted PDF files, text-only files with broken formatting, or completely empty documents, wasting your time and exposing you to ads for no reward. Legal and Ethical Implications

Scribd regularly offers a 30-day free trial for new users. This trial grants unrestricted access to their entire library of premium documents, audiobooks, and e-books. If you only need to download a specific set of research papers for a short-term project, you can sign up for the trial, download the files legally, and cancel the subscription before the billing cycle begins.
